Separation generally adopts permanent magnet drum type magnetic separator.Most magnetite beneficiation plants often adopt coarse-grained dry magnetic separation tailings. For the ultra-lean magnetite ore with a grade below 20.00%, the ultra-fine crushing-wet magnetic separation tailing process can be used before entering the mill.

CIL (Carbon In Leach), the gold carbon leaching method, is the carbon leaching method for gold extraction.Normally, the CIL process can concentrate gold from 2.5–3.5 g/t in ore to 2000 to 6000 g/t in carbon. The CIL gold process is suitable for beneficiating oxidized gold ore with low sulfur and mud content; Or process the gold tailings after gravity separation …

The most common and notable example of this are precious metal values (gold, silver etc.) where the beneficiation process is applied directly on run-of-mine ores followed by the extraction of gold and in some cases silver as a relatively pure metal within the mineral processing circuit.
